Some days only a big slipjoint will do. For days like that, there’s the Great Eastern Cutlery #54 Tidioute “Big Moose.”
Its four-inch frame holds a pair of full-size blades — a clip and a spear, both of 1095 carbon steel — along with three brass liners and nickel-silver bolsters. This one is scaled in maroon linen Micarta.
Beefy and classy, the GEC #54 Big Moose is one very handsome pocketknife.
